New Border Crossing Project Sparks Concern in Prespa Region
The “Markovska noga – Lesoski” border crossing is being developed as a strategic project for the Prespa region and the broader Balkans. The initiative is spearheaded by Macedonian Minister of Internal Affairs, Pancho Toshkovski, and focuses on constructing the Macedonian-Greek border. Toshkovski stated that the goal is to elevate Prespa as a prominent micro-location within Europe.
However, he acknowledged the project’s potential negative consequences for both Macedonia and Greece, describing it as a “strategic project that will give added negative impact” to the region. The minister anticipates the construction of the border crossing from the Macedonian side to be completed by September of this year. The full project completion timeline remains under development.
The development of this border crossing is intended to bolster regional infrastructure, though it has raised concerns regarding its impact on relations between Macedonia and Greece. Further details regarding the project’s overall scope and completion date are expected to be released in the coming months. —
